    What Fitness Supplements Should You Take?

    5 Mins Read
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    Taking fitness supplements can be a great way to enhance your workouts and your overall health. However, it can be a little confusing as to which ones to take. Here are a few things to consider before you begin.

    Creatine

    Creatine is one of the most commonly used sports supplements. It is a metabolite of fatty acids and amino acids that the body makes to fuel its muscles. Adding monohydrate creatine to your diet can boost your performance and help you stay motivated.

    One of the most important functions of creatine is its ability to boost your endurance during workouts. It also helps you improve your strength and recovery time.

    This nutrient can be found in a variety of foods, from meat and fish to poultry and dairy products. However, the largest quantity of it is stored in the muscles.

    To get the most benefits from a creatine supplement, you should take it in moderation. Taking a lot of it can lead to gastrointestinal distress, as well as an increased water weight.

    Whey

    Whey protein is a great supplement for people who need extra energy or protein to meet their daily goals. It can also help keep your muscles strong and healthy as you age.

    Protein is essential for building muscle. Increasing your intake of protein can limit fat gain during periods of excessive calorie intake. And it can reduce the desire to snack between meals.

    If you’re not sure how much protein you should be consuming, the American College of Sports Medicine recommends a minimum of 0.5 grams of protein for every pound of body weight. This can be spread out throughout the day. But if you’re looking to build muscle, your goal should be to consume at least 100 to 200 grams of protein per day.

    L-citrulline

    L-citrulline is an amino acid that helps athletes improve their workout performance and is also common in diet pills. It also has other health benefits. Among them, it may help reduce blood pressure.

    Besides, it can also improve heart health. This amino acid is also good for muscle growth. It promotes the release of growth hormones, which may boost muscle growth. The supplement is often used in bodybuilding formulas. Using it in the right dosage will also help enhance performance.

    Citrulline is a non-essential amino acid, but your body can synthesize it when you need it. There are some foods that contain it, like watermelon and kidney beans. However, some supplements, such as l citrulline malate, also contain it.

    Beta-alanine

    Beta-Alanine is a naturally occurring non-essential amino acid that plays an important role in the production of a di-peptide called carnosine in the body. Carnosine helps prevent muscles from becoming acidic during intense exercise. This reduces muscle fatigue and improves endurance.

    A recent review by the NSCA (National Strength and Conditioning Association) suggests that Beta-Alanine is indeed a good training supplement. However, not all beta-alanine supplements are created equal. In fact, there are some products out there that may have more than a hundred banned substances in them, so be sure to read the label.

    Beta-Alanine is an effective supplement for improving one-rep max, and it can also increase overall workout volume. As a result, you’ll be able to lift more weight, which will translate to increased strength and endurance.

    Omega 3

    Omega 3 supplements are a great way to improve your workout performance. They boost blood flow to your muscles, reduce inflammation, and increase muscle recovery. These nutrients also promote healthy joints.

    Research shows that omega-3 fatty acids decrease muscle loss during prolonged periods of rest and improve muscle recovery. This may reduce the risk of brittle bones and joint replacements.

    The best way to take omega-3 fatty acids is to eat wild-caught fish. Alternatively, algae oils may offer a sustainable alternative to fish oil. If you have health concerns about consuming fish oil, consider krill oil.

    Omega 3 fatty acids may also help increase muscle strength and endurance. Studies have shown that omega-3 fatty acids reduce perceived pain after exercise and decrease the duration of exercise-induced muscle damage.

    L-glutamine

    Glutamine is a conditionally essential amino acid that plays an important role in muscle development. It is found naturally in the body, but it can also be taken as a supplement.

    Supplementation with L-glutamine can speed up the recovery time after a strenuous workout. It can also help prevent muscle wasting.

    Aside from its benefits for the digestive system, l-glutamine can boost the immune system. This may help to fight disease and reduce the risk of infections.

    L-glutamine is an amino acid that plays an important role in glucose uptake by muscles. It also aids in the repair of skeletal muscle.

    Studies have shown that glutamine can improve athletic performance and reduce the pain caused by exercise-induced muscle soreness. Research also shows that it can help treat leaky gut. Leaky gut can contribute to skin problems, arthritis, and thyroid issues.
